Output ece1396e9f1f26551b287615dc48c6f0ba25ea1888355ab48cf6c1cc17fa0bb1:26

value
62915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26975ce278a94e6b71d9167d5eaa80148835fcbf OP_EQUAL
address
35D4vhy8m4oGcDL9SpqL6SLGgVRSwKihnB
transaction
ece1396e9f1f26551b287615dc48c6f0ba25ea1888355ab48cf6c1cc17fa0bb1
confirmations
293826
spent
true